Output e324a5836c0f46c47fb91ac44ba74383c0e1d140266065f32def3e52257648ba:1

value
50779
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4f750c28d287787df26a53f0c10644d82e1a029f OP_EQUALVERIFY OP_CHECKSIG
address
18F8bkvfSDPmVT8iurukZDXPij39fR7riy
transaction
e324a5836c0f46c47fb91ac44ba74383c0e1d140266065f32def3e52257648ba
confirmations
526313
spent
true